The grade specific ed major at Newberry College is not ranked on College Factual’s Best Colleges and Universities for Teacher Education Grade Specific. This could be for a number of reasons, such as not having enough data on the major or school to make an accurate assessment of its quality.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, Newberry College handed out 13 bachelor's degrees in teacher education grade specific. This is an increase of 8% over the previous year when 12 degrees were handed out.
While getting their bachelor's degree at Newberry College, grade specific ed students borrow a median amount of $27,000 in student loans. This is higher than the the typical median of $26,099 for all grade specific ed majors across the country.

During the 2020-2021 academic year, 13 students graduated with a bachelor's degree in grade specific ed from Newberry College. About 8% were men and 92% were women.
The majority of the students with this major are white. About 77% of 2021 graduates were in this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Newberry College with a bachelor's in grade specific ed.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 1 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 10 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 2 |
